    Maximus is currently hiring for a Quality Assurance Specialist! This is a full-time remote opportunity and will be providing support for our Independent Practitioner Program. Maximus administers the Independent Practitioner Panel, which completes assessment reviews and issues practitioner orders for New Yorkers who qualify for long-term in-home care. This is an exciting new program that directly contributes to positive long-term outcomes for vulnerable populations in New York State.

    P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Maintains consumer complaint database; researches consumer complaints; forwards to appropriate party for investigation; tracks investigation response and follow-ups as required to ensure timely response

    • Performs quality control and maintains QA Databases related to IPP documentation audits and other QA department activities

    • Researches QA issues as directed by QA Manager

    • Organizes and maintains all QA documents, files, spreadsheets, databases, reports, and materials.

    • Utilizes MAXeb tm and other systems applications to create reports on an ad-hoc basis that track and trend activities / outcome

    • Participates in the development of project goals and objectives, and monitoring achievement of those goals

    • Escalates potential issues to QA Management

    • Ensures reports are accurate and all standards are being met

    • Meets all standards established for this position as outlined in the corresponding annual performance criteria and bonus template for this position

    • Performs other duties as may be assigned by the Quality Assurance Managers and Director

    JOB REQUIREMENTS:

    • Bachelor’s degree in business, education, computer science, statistics, health, social services, or related field, is required

    • 1-3 years working in a quality assurance or related position

    • Strong analytical skills; detail and solution oriented; experience in a quality assurance position in health or human services field

    • Ability to work independently

    • Excellent written and oral communication and presentation skills

    • Ability to use spreadsheet or database software, including MS Office
